Hello everyone,

I'm trying to install VDR on my linuxmce machine. There's a catch,  
though: I can only use the regular multiproto drivers from a few weeks  
ago since the new ones (and the multiproto plus driver) won't "detect"  
my DVB-S2 S2-3200 card.

The multiproto drivers I'm trying to use are a few months old, from  
march, and they're the only ones who will work. (I can use szap with  
them, anyway)

The problem is, when I try to compile VDR using this tutorial  
(http://www.vdr-wiki.de/wiki/index.php/OpenSUSE_VDR_DVB-S2_-_xine_-_Teil3) I  
get this error message:

         g++ -g -O2 -Wall -Woverloaded-virtual -Wno-parentheses -c  
-DREMOTE_KBD -DLIRC_DEVICE=\"/dev/lircd\" -DRCU_DEVICE=\"/dev/ttyS1\"  
-D_GNU_SOURCE -DVIDEODIR=\"/video\" -DCONFDIR=\"/video\"  
-DPLUGINDIR=\"./PLUGINS/lib\" -DLOCDIR=\"./locale\"  
-I/usr/include/freetype2 -I/opt/dvb/multiproto/linux/include dvbdevice.c
         dvbdevice.c: In member function ?bool cDvbTuner::SetFrontend()?:
         dvbdevice.c:302: error: ?DVBFE_SET_DELSYS? was not declared  
in this scope
         make: *** [dvbdevice.o] Error 1


Which I think indicates it's some kind of problem between VDR and the  
old drivers, is this correct? I pointed to the correct DVBDIR in the  
Make.config file so ...
How can I fix it?
